Maximizing Your Accountant Earnings in Rahway

In Rahway, specialists in fields such as tax accounting—whether for individuals or corporations—often secure upper-tier salaries, reflecting the demand for high-level expertise in complex financial matters. Roles in audit and internal control, as well as forensic accounting, also command premium compensation, especially within organizations such as the Big 4 accounting firms (Deloitte, PwC, EY, KPMG). Senior accountants may find differing pay scales depending on their employer type, with corporate environments typically offering competitive salaries but less prestige compared to partnerships in public firms. Growth paths for seasoned accountants can vary significantly, offering routes towards becoming a partner in public practice or moving into high-level corporate positions such as controller or CFO. Advanced credentials, including a CPA license and potentially a Master's degree in Accounting or Tax, can substantially increase pay in NJ, while non-salary benefits such as bonuses or overtime during tax season provide additional financial incentives for dedicated professionals in this field.
